Meeting Point and Logistics
Upon arrival at the Bargello Museum for the private tour, visitors should seek out the guide with a Purple Florence With Locals flag at the main entrance on Via del Proconsolo, 4. It’s recommended to arrive at the meeting point approximately 15 minutes before the tour starts to ensure a timely departure.
The meeting instructions are clear, with the guide waiting at the designated spot to kick off the experience smoothly. Plus, the meeting point at the Bargello Museum is wheelchair accessible, ensuring that all participants can easily join the tour. For those with accessibility needs, the location provides options to accommodate their requirements, making it inclusive for all visitors.
